使用Docker建立QUANTAXIS执行环境

使用Docker建立QUANTAXIS执行环境

昨天有又试了一下使用Docker建立QUANTAXIS执行环境,没想到成功了,按照官方教程,具体步骤如下:

获取QUANTAIS镜像

首先,到docker网站下载相应的版本,并创建账号(注意:登录docker账号才能下载镜像)。

执行以下命令获取镜

1
docker pull registry.cn-shanghai.aliyuncs.com/yutiansut/quantaxis

结果:

1
2
3
4
5
$ docker pull registry.cn-shanghai.aliyuncs.com/yutiansut/quantaxis
Using default tag: latest
latest: Pulling from yutiansut/quantaxis
Digest: sha256:a99d0872a49cbb5ec4cb0ca1935b246fc551303c5a8f00dac16a622a6662d54f
Status: Image is up to date for registry.cn-shanghai.aliyuncs.com/yutiansut/quantaxis:latest

运行镜像

1
2
# 带jupyter版本
docker run -it -e GRANT_SUDO=yes -p 8888:8888 -p 8080:8080 -p 3000:3000 registry.cn-shanghai.aliyuncs.com/yutiansut/quantaxis

在docker中执行命令(启动服务)

1
2
3
4
5
6
7
# 启动 mongodb    
cd /home/quantaxis/config && nohup sh ./run_backend.sh &
# 启动 WEBKIT
cd /home/quantaxis/QUANTAXIS_Webkit/backend && forever start ./bin/www
cd /home/quantaxis/QUANTAXIS_Webkit/web && forever start ./build/dev-server.js
# 启动jupyter
cd /home/quantaxis/config && nohup sh ./startjupyter.sh &

然后在浏览器中打开:http://localhost:8080/

另外最近也加入了QA的群聊中,下载了QA的Desktop版本,看起来和Webkit功能一样。QA Desktop

暂时还没弄明白这个账户是怎么回事,猜想应该是QA建立的账户。

# Python

评论

程振兴

程振兴 @czxa.top
截止今天,我已经在本博客上写了607.9k个字了!

Your browser is out-of-date!

Update your browser to view this website correctly. Update my browser now

×